The Divisional Controller is responsible for working with the Group Controller, Business Unit Managers, Project Managers and Corporate Finance team, to provide support with their business activities in the areas of accounting, administration, internal controls, and information systems. This position reports to the Group Controller, Finance.

**Responsibilities**:

- Prepare monthly business unit statements, financial review information and annual business unit budgets and assist business unit managers in the financial planning processes
- Together with management, hold monthly business reviews with each business unit and report to the executive team
- Understand and support implementation of cost control, job costing and forecasting systems at the project level
- Assist with internal and external audits as required
- Provide analysis and support to business unit managers to ensure understanding of business unit statements and financial implications of business decisions
- Perform monthly divisional profit/revenue recognition, develop and analyze monthly cost reporting, and project forecasts
- Investigate profitability issues and forecasts changes
- Maintain tracking of intercompany billings and accruals for internal charges according to corporate accounting standards
- Maintain balance sheet and sub ledgers and manage inventory accounting for the specific business units
- Assist staff with daily process issues and process improvement, ensuring adequate internal controls are in place
- Lead and develop individuals within different business units
- Other duties as required

**Requirements**:

- 5+ years’ relevant experience as a Controller or similar role
- Experience in Construction Industry is strongly preferred
- Professional accounting designation, or working towards a professional accounting designation
- Previous supervisory experience
- Ability to analyze and interpret financial data and excellent verbal and written communications
- Advanced experience with MS Excel
- Some travel is required to different divisions and project locations
